Maiden wet test of India's Samudrayaan mission scheduled in last week of October

The Indian government is set to perform the first wet test of the manned ocean mission, Samudrayaan, at Chennai harbour in late October. The test aims to evaluate Matsya-6000, a deep-submergence vehicle intended for deep-sea exploration of rare minerals. This mission, approved in 2021, involves a three-member crew trained by the Institute of Naval Medicine.
